Output 51a0761d162de8c80be41f3eb77f18dbab378bce4236e4556f94195893abdb88:0

value
31714766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4aeb231f380aa7aa6a9868cc2a5bade5b32e3ce OP_EQUAL
address
3KcyeEnqfW2C9UUDZJ5qeSh6ZYvq1X55U1
transaction
51a0761d162de8c80be41f3eb77f18dbab378bce4236e4556f94195893abdb88
spent
true